Like father, like son: Bill England is building nutshells to grow the fleet

Nutshell racing on the Great Wicomico River will resume in May.

Meanwhile, Bill England is at it again. He is building a few new nutshells for the local fleet and hoping to have them completed by the start of the season, reported Ellen Sagan.

His father, Nick England, built the first nutshell pram on the Northern Neck in 1988-89 in his workshop at Glebe Point. He enjoyed the experience so much, he decided to build a fleet. He reached out to men who were interested….
